Study: Mobile use spreading into the home
Mobile services and applications designed primarily for business environments are spilling into homes, according to a new IDC study reported by ZDNet. "Survey respondents stated that nearly 36% of their personal calls from home are made from their mobile phone and that they spend more on cellular service per month than on broadband, cable/satellite TV, and landline telephone services. Mobile consumers also tended to adopt more of the latest technology and consumer electronic products, from wireless networks to big flat screen TVs." cf IDC press release: This study, "Mobilizing the Consumer: 2003 Survey Results (IDC #30441)", reviews the latest survey findings from IDC’s Mobile User panel on current and planned personal use of mobility solutions. |
